Web1 Sep 2024 · Half of South Africa’s adults live below the poverty line — and are likely to experience violence in childhood or later in life. In South Africa half of adults are living below the poverty line, defined as earning an income of less than R1 183 per month. Similarly, experiences of violence in childhood and later life are common.

Web9 Sep 2024 · A person in South Africa now needs to have at least R624 per month to meet the minimum required daily energy intake, according to a report released by Statistics SA on Thursday. It released the inflation-adjusted national poverty lines (NPLs) report for 2024, which showed that adjustments were made due to the increasing high cost of living.
